There is always something intimate, personal, about Fekete’s photographs, but not sentimentally personal; there is rather a point of reference, a sign of life- an object, a figure, a light, a movement- that connects the viewer with what sees. Here something has definitely changed. This is not a new townscape but a new lifestyle, the capital’s new pulse, its changed biorhythm. He has discovered something that no one else has documented, at least as far as this city was concerned. It is hard to imagine a local photographer being as dispassionate and admirer of the Budapest scene as Gábor Fekete. He harbours no prejudice, has no secret agenda. Generally speaking he does not beautify, but neither does he delight in ugliness. He is not affected by the common clichés, complexes, commonplaces. He discovers, enjoys, is surprised. He takes photographs as if he were seeing this city for the first time. That, surely, is why he succeeds in persuading those that view his photographs that they too are seeing it for the first time.
